一种面向硬件实现的模数混合混沌真随机数发生器
Hardware-Oriented Modular Hybrid Chaotic True Random Number Generator
解旭辉 1胡汉平 2郑俊 3曾宇1
作者信息
- 1. 华中科技大学 人工智能与自动化学院,武汉 430074
- 2. 华中科技大学 人工智能与自动化学院,武汉 430074;图像信息处理与智能控制教育部重点实验室,武汉 430074
- 3. 华中科技大学 网络空间安全学院,武汉 430074
- 折叠
摘要
在信息安全领域,随机数发生器的应用越来越广泛.混沌的类随机性和不可预测性可以被用来设计性能良好的随机数发生器,然而,当混沌系统在数字电路实现时,会出现退化,存在严重的安全问题.本文利用模数混合混沌模型设计和实现了低成本、高效率的真随机数发生器,通过用两级比较器代替 ADC实现混沌量化获得真随机比特以减少资源消耗,以易于硬件实现的梳状混沌映射为基本单元构造了超混沌系统,模拟混沌系统采用光混沌方程实现简单且可以获得更高的速率.利用 FPGA 和 FPAA 对真随机数发生器进行联合硬件实现,整体电路简单,以相对较低的资源开销产生的真随机序列具有高稳定性和优良的统计性能,通过了 NIST SP800 标准随机性测试以及最为严格的 TestU01 测试.该设计有望集成到专用芯片中并广泛用于网络安全的各个领域.
Abstract
In the field of information security,the application of random number generator is more and more extensive.The quasi-randomness and unpredictability of chaos can be used to design a random number generator with sound performance.Nevertheless,when the chaotic system is imple-mented in digital circuit,it will degrade and there will be serious security problems.In this study,a low-cost and high-efficiency true random number generator is designed and implemented by using an analog-digital hybrid chaos model.A two-stage comparator is used instead of ADC to achieve chaos quantization and obtain true random bits to reduce resource consumption.A hyperchaotic system is constructed using a comb-shaped chaos map that is easy to implement in hardware as the basic unit.The simulation of chaotic system uses the optical chaos equation to achieve a simple and higher rate.Using FPGA and FPAA,the joint hardware implementation of true random number generator is carried out.The overall circuit is simple,and the true random sequence generated with relatively low resource cost has high stability and excellent statistical performance.It has passed the NIST SP800 standard randomness test and the most stringent TestU01 test.The design is expected to be integrated into special chip and widely used in various fields of network security.
关键词
真随机数发生器/模数混合/FPGA/超混沌Key words
true random number generator/analog digital hybrid/FPGA/hyper-chaos引用本文复制引用
出版年
2024